Physiotherapy Home Care: The Convenience of In-Home Therapy

In addition to visiting a clinic, physiotherapy home care is becoming an increasingly popular option for patients who prefer the convenience of receiving treatment in the comfort of their homes. For many people, travelling to a clinic for physiotherapy sessions can be difficult, especially for those with limited mobility, elderly patients, or individuals recovering from surgery.

Physiotherapy home care allows you to receive personalised care from a physiotherapist in your own environment. This is particularly beneficial for patients who have trouble getting around or for those who want to avoid the hassle of commuting. A “near me physiotherapist” who offers home care services can come directly to your home, ensuring that you get the necessary treatment without needing to leave your house.

Additionally, in-home physiotherapy allows the therapist to assess your living environment and make recommendations to improve safety and mobility. For instance, the physiotherapist can identify potential fall risks in your home and suggest ways to make your environment more comfortable and accessible. This level of personalised care can significantly improve the outcomes of your rehabilitation and overall well-being.

Evaluate the Physiotherapist’s Treatment Approach

When you find a “near me physiotherapist,” it’s important to understand their treatment approach. Physiotherapists use a combination of manual therapy, exercises, and other techniques to help patients recover. The methods and tools used can vary based on the therapist’s style, expertise, and the patient’s specific needs.

During your initial consultation, ask the physiotherapist about the techniques they use. A good physiotherapist should be able to explain their treatment plan clearly and provide you with an understanding of how it will help you recover. It’s also helpful to ask about their experience with different modalities, such as dry needling, ultrasound therapy, or electrical stimulation, to ensure they can tailor their approach to your specific needs.

Insurance and Costs

Cost is often an important consideration when choosing a physiotherapist. Before booking your appointment, check if your insurance covers physiotherapy services, either in a clinic or at home. Many insurance plans offer coverage for physiotherapy, but it’s important to confirm the details, such as coverage limits, copays, and whether home care services are included.

In-home physiotherapy may be slightly more expensive than clinic visits, but it can be worth the extra cost for the added convenience and personalised care. Some physiotherapists may offer package deals or discounts for home visits, so it’s worth asking about pricing and payment options before starting treatment.
